I recently had to clean and lube the bearings and took this picture of the bottom of the Neumann suspension box.
The coil is on the left. It's basically a speaker motor with a shaft connected. The shaft attaches to the bottom of the head mount on the right. The head mounts on the right side of this box. Bearings allow for rotation of the head mount. When the coil moves the head rotates causing the the tip of the stylus to move up or down. Very simple. Very clever.
